Star Citizen Offers 11 Days Free Play

Enormously driven space simulator Star Citizen will be permitted to free-to-try later this week during another of its free fly events. Anyone who has a record of flying will be able to test new ships from 22 May to 1 June regardless of their purchase.

A free flight opportunity a year ago allowed you to try all the game’s flights, but this one highlights the UEE Navy. As before, the open ships should swing periodically, so you can ask to test new ones.

RSI’s Invictus Launch Week directly gives you all the subtleties when it starts. If you’re new to Star Citizen, engineers invite you to acclimatize, incomplete for what it’s worth, and record yourself with the game. At 11 pm BST/3 pm PDT, new players can start their 11-day free trial.

New and existing players also have the option of entering a variety of ships in the cockpit, with manufacturers turning regularly.
